Transaction 5aeefcf9159d9692eb16f5ee236d8aaf3851fcf61cde675abb7b380e703251fb
1 Input
1 Output
-
5aeefcf9159d9692eb16f5ee236d8aaf3851fcf61cde675abb7b380e703251fb:0
- value
- 5331337
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9d9af63190aa826aa57afd483b78044c19c03a94 OP_EQUAL
- address
- 3G4Meb5Y7FrNGZb1sjwxrJEqhWYQU7N6YV